Introducing our first faculty bio of the 2024-25 season… Meet Briarwood Ballet’s Executive Director, Peggy Townes!
Peggy Barker Townes grew up in Birmingham, AL dancing under the instruction of her mother, Barbara Barker. Towards the end of high school, Peggy discovered a love for musical theatre and went on to attend Samford University as a theater major under Harold Hunt. During her college years Peggy performed leading roles in many shows including The Sound of Music, Gigi, The Music Man, You’re a Good Man, Charlie Brown, My Fair Lady, Summer and Smoke, as well as some period pieces such as Moliere’s The Misanthrope and Sheridan’s The Rivals. In 1986 she had her first opportunity to direct a show for which she was rewarded the Bonnie Bolding Swearingen Award for Best Director. In the following years Peggy joined the faculty at Briarwood Ballet, founded a children’s theater program called NarrowWay Kids, and co-founded MoTowne Productions alongside Tammy Moore. In 2012, God made it clear that He was calling Peggy to step away from children’s theatre and accept the position of Executive Director of Briarwood Ballet. Although she accepted the job with fear and trembling, Peggy has delighted in the privilege of continuing her mother’s vision and legacy. Serving the Lord alongside the best staff and faculty to train young dancers to use their gifts in worship of our Savior is an amazing calling.

We are excited to announce Brittany Bischoff as Briarwood Ballet’s Artistic Director for the 2024-25 season!
Mrs. Brittany has been teaching at Briarwood Ballet since 2012, working closely with and choreographing on Ballet Exaltation for the past several years. In the spring of 2023 she stepped into the position of interim artistic director, and this year we are thrilled to have her step into the role fully.
We are grateful to have a leader who remains humble while pursuing excellence, but more importantly we are thankful to have an artistic director who loves and seeks the Lord first.
